Microbial compound phosphorus and potassium bacterial fertilizer for promoting nutrient absorption and preparation method thereof

This invention relates to the field of microbial fertilizer technology, specifically to a microbial compound phosphorus and potassium fertilizer that promotes nutrient absorption and its preparation method. The preparation method of a microbial compound phosphorus and potassium fertilizer that promotes nutrient absorption includes: preparing sunflower disc extract and Moringa leaf extract; preparing slow-release microcapsules; preparing microspheres loaded with bacteria; and preparing the compound phosphorus and potassium fertilizer. This invention first selectively oxidizes konjac glucomannan using sodium periodate, then crosslinks the oxidized konjac glucomannan with lignin under weakly acidic conditions to form a three-dimensional network crosslinked polymer framework. Urea and dipotassium hydrogen phosphate are encapsulated in the network channels or adsorbed onto the framework during the crosslinking process, forming nutrient-loaded slow-release microcapsules. After the slow-release microcapsules are made into a compound phosphorus and potassium fertilizer and applied, nutrients are gradually released as the crop grows, which helps improve nutrient absorption and utilization, thereby promoting nutrient absorption.

Process method for comprehensively treating corn soaking water and obtaining inositol and potassium struvite

PendingCN122012633AMagnesium phosphate fertilisersMagnesium double phosphate fertilisersSimulated moving bedMoving bed
The invention relates to the technical field of corn soaking water treatment, in particular to a process method for comprehensively treating corn soaking water and obtaining inositol and potassium struvite, which comprises the following steps: treating corn soaking water supernatant as a raw material by first cation and first anion resin columns; the collected desorption solution is subjected to concentration, ultrasonic enzymolysis, decoloration and simulated moving bed chromatographic separation, an obtained inositol phase enters a second cation resin column and a second anion resin column, and an inositol product is obtained through concentration crystallization and drying; adding magnesium chloride hexahydrate into the collected salt phase, adjusting the pH value, filtering, respectively collecting precipitate (potassium struvite) and filtrate, concentrating and crystallizing the filtrate, filtering, and carrying out bipolar membrane electrodialysis treatment on the collected crystallization mother liquor; according to the process method, inositol and potassium struvite products can be obtained, phosphorus and potassium in the corn soaking water are recycled, resource waste is avoided, consumption of a resolving agent (potassium chloride) is reduced, and cost is saved.

Preparation method of mineral conditioner based on phosphorus and potassium synergistic activation of low-grade potassium phosphate ore

The invention belongs to the technical field of chemical production, and provides a preparation method of a mineral conditioner based on phosphorus-potassium synergistic activation of low-grade potassium phosphorite, and synchronous deconstruction and nutrient release of potassium feldspar and apatite are realized through a mechanical ball milling-thermal activation-hydrothermal activation three-stage synergistic activation system. The method comprises the following steps: performing mechanical ball milling on potassium phosphate rock powder and ammonium sulfate according to a mass ratio of 20: 1 for 1 hour, performing thermal activation at 400 DEG C for 6 hours, mixing with quick lime according to a ratio of 7: 2, performing ball milling, and performing hydrothermal reaction at 180 DEG C for 16 hours to obtain a product. According to the invention, the problems of difficult synergism of phosphorus and potassium activation, complex flow and high energy consumption in the traditional process are solved, and the obtained mineral conditioner has main nutrients of phosphorus and potassium and various trace elements, and can be directly applied. The method is suitable for efficient utilization of low-grade potassium phosphate ore resources, and has the advantages of simple process, low energy consumption, environmental friendliness and the like.
